Applications
Ethyl 3-methyl-3-(p-tolyl)glycidate is used primarily as a fragrance intermediate in perfumery and cosmetics, contributing distinctive aroma notes and serving as a synthetic building block for related aroma compounds; it is also considered an active epoxy-functional ester used in polymer and coating formulations (coatings/inks, adhesives) to enable crosslinking or post-modification. In industrial manufacturing, it can act as an intermediate to prepare glycidyl esters and other derivatives; in chemical synthesis, it may serve as a starting material for pharmaceutical intermediates under appropriate regulatory controls; in household products it can act as a fragrance ingredient or odorant, subject to local regulatory compliance.
